import { jest } from "@jest/globals";
import fs from "fs";
import path from "path";
import ClangPlugin from "./ClangPlugin.js";
describe("ClangPlugin", () => {
describe("validateClangExecutable", () => {
it("should return the clang executable name when given a valid command", async () => {
const executableName = "clang -o main main.c";
await expect(
ClangPlugin.validateClangExecutable(executableName)
).resolves.toBeUndefined();
});
it("should throw an error when given an invalid command", async () => {
const executableName = "gcc -o main main.c";
await expect(
ClangPlugin.validateClangExecutable(executableName)
).rejects.toThrow("Could not find clang executable");
});
});
